>Hawk Mountain's Sparrowhawk.

This paper is a nicer weight (220gsm) and the reverse side has a slight texture.

It gives good results as long as there are not large areas of solid black, which lack the evenness of Kayenta or PremierArt Matte BW.

It's excellent for greeting cards
